YOUNG TALENTS

At the iba BackStage young talent days from 21 to 23 October 2023, committed apprentices can show what they are made of. They will take part in exciting competitions and training sessions, meet prominent personalities from the bakery trade and make contacts along the way. The successful pilot project of the German Bakers‘ Confederation offers all that and much more.

Don't miss out: The CONFERENCE FOR EUROPEAN TORTILLA & FLATBREADS will take place for the first time at the Fairground Munich from October 24th to 25th, 2023, parallel to iba. At the Tortilla Industry Association Congress, you can connect with tortilla and flatbread experts from over 21 countries and learn everything about the rapidly growing sector of the bakery industry.

iba.DIGITALISATION AREA

Make your company more digital - but how? At the iba.DIGITALISATION AREA, iba offers you a holistic overview of the topic of sand how it can reshape various company areas and processes. The area will pick you up where you want to start with your digitisation measures. In five subcategories, you can use the theory and practice area to determine in interlocking steps how you can initiate digitisation - and then immediately get in touch with experts who can support you in this regard.
